Meet Highland Park Photographer: Peter Lefevre

Today we’d like to introduce you to Peter Lefevre.

Peter, please share your story with us. How did you get to where you are today?
I studied photography in high school shooting on an old Canon film camera. I only shot black and white at the time. Over the years I was the only friend in my group to bring along my camera to parties and concerts. I loved capturing moments and memories that would have been lost forever, this was before everyone had a cell phone camera. Once digital came around I had a new found passion for photography and I threw myself into it. Since then I’ve shot concerts/festivals, band photos, red carpets, and lookbooks. I’ve never looked back.

Has it been a smooth road?
There are always struggles to this business, finding work, connecting with your audience and finding your niche. My best advice would be, as cliche as this may sound, is to be yourself and shoot what you love. The rest will follow. Because if you’re excited and love what you’re shooting that will come through in your work.

Have you ever wanted to stop doing what you do and just start over?
There were definitely moments I felt like quitting or giving up. When I felt like that I decided the best way to get inspired again was to read a book, meditate or go shoot a landscape. Whatever it was I had to step outside myself and remind myself that every artist has these moments but you must never give up otherwise you’ll never realize your full potential. The road to success is never a straight line.

What advice do you wish to give to those thinking about pursuing a path similar to yours?
Network and build your brand. Shoot anything and everything that comes your way. Find what you love to shoot and what you’re good at. What is it that gets you excited and doesn’t feel like work? Do that.
